Sen. John McCain said that Attorney General Eric Holder has no credibility with Congress because of the Fast and Furious controversy in an interview on CNN’s “State of the Union” Sunday. Discussing Holder’s appointment of two U.S. attorneys to investigate the leaking of classified national security information, McCain disagreed that that was the right way to go. 

“Mr. Holder’s credibility with Congress is — there is none,” McCain said. “As you know we continue to have this problem with him withholding information on fast and furious…there is no credibility.”

McCain renewed his call for a special counsel who is separate from the Justice Department and suggested former Republican Senator Bob Bennett as someone who could lead the investigation.
